[PATCH v2 04/14] common/sfc_efx/base: reduce stack in netport stat describe

Ivan Malov ivan.malov at arknetworks.am
Wed Aug 12 19:08:24 CEST 2026


From: Andy Moreton <andy.moreton at amd.com>

Code analysis reports an error for excessive stack consumption
(over 1KB). Use a heap allocated payload buffer instead.
